In 2016, I wanted to get back to running.  I started out doing too much too soon right out of the gate. I would lace up and run five miles and the truth was that I wasn’t even prepared to run one.  You know what happened right? I developed plantar fasciitis on one foot and even worse, I had a fallen arch on the other. YIKES!!  The podiatrist prescribed orthotics and I has assigned “no running” for too long. I tried all the methods I could find on the internet to “fix” my problem sooner so I could start all over again.

And now it’s 2017 and things are totally different for me.  I started out by lacing up and running slowly and in small increments. I started with stretching and core and strength training as my primary workout and added a little running in between. Slowly but surely, I am really running now and I’m doing it very comfortably and I’m finding some small successes.
